Transaction 33135e24b46ea7487e1827991a4eee84641e4e6f674c85a2d1c8996eedac0160

1 Input
2 Outputs
  • 33135e24b46ea7487e1827991a4eee84641e4e6f674c85a2d1c8996eedac0160:0
  • value  4406194
    address  325kF1fvHd2Z5Ag688m92kQncSNgDrJUyG
  • 33135e24b46ea7487e1827991a4eee84641e4e6f674c85a2d1c8996eedac0160:1
  • value  19377856
    address  39Km37jPryeiFdSgd9qrf5EeC2rG113Zwu